Expect the unexpected in Real Estate, If you’re not, you’re setting yourself up for disaster.  When buying homes that are older, examine and/or test the utilities going from the street to the home. Without digging up everything there is really no way to know what’s really going on under there. If you feel there maybe an issue because the home has, a wet basement, really green patches in the yard, water leaching through a wall or maybe an odor or dampness. Right then and there you should consider getting an specific inspection on the problem area. Although there really is no way to fully know if there’s an issue, you can have certain tests performed to take precaution against potential future expenses.

Sometimes even the best test cannot protect you against the unknown, so sometimes you just have to take the plunge. Stay calm, if your home for sale in Lancaster Pa expired. We have several strategies to sell your home. Although I do understand it’s frustrating.

First thing, You’re not the only expired listing in Lancaster Pa. There are many things to do make your home more saleable thing next time around.  If you’re interested, I have four key points to determine what you would like to do, for your own knowledge.

1. Communication- Did your agent keep you updated and aware of what showings and buyers had to say about the home. Did you keep your agent up to date inregards to changes to the home?

2. How is your home priced?

  • Unfortunatly current market condition may not bring you what you have in to the home or what you feel it may be worth.
  • Tune into current market conditons via your realtor.

3.Condition-

  • Ask your agent to be objective about the condition of your property
  • Got Stuff? Do you need to declutter, remove some of the pictures and personal items you have so the prospective buyer can imagine themselves in the home.

4. How is your home being presented to the market?

  • Marketing is key, even the best marketing won’t sell an overpriced or less than desirable home.
  • The best marketing coupled with the best price should sell your home
